Securing The Lowest Orlando Rental Car Prices – Save Big While Exploring Central Florida! starts with understanding how rental pricing operates. Budget-friendly rates depend on timing, provider strategy, and booking flexibility. Off-peak seasons, weekly deals, and comparing platforms help reduce costs significantly compared to standard rates. Major rental companies use dynamic pricing, adjusting fees based on demand, holidays, and availability. Booking early or using price-tracking tools ensures travelers access the best rates, while membership perks and seasonal promotions often unlock additional savings. Transparency in pricing—free cancellations, inclusive fees—builds trust and supports smarter decisions.
